Tex. Spec. Dist. Local Laws Code Section 8845.151
Maintenance and Operations Tax; Election


(a)

The district may annually impose an ad valorem tax on property in the district for use in maintaining district facilities and paying district operating expenses.

(b)

The district may not impose a maintenance and operations tax until it is approved by a majority vote of the district voters voting at an election held for that purpose.

(c)

The directors shall publish notice of a maintenance and operations tax election at least one time in a newspaper or newspapers that have general circulation in the district. The notice must be published before the 30th day preceding the date of the election.

(d)

The directors shall declare the result of a maintenance and operations tax election.
Added by Acts 2011, 82nd Leg., R.S., Ch. 70 (S.B. 1147), Sec. 1.03, eff. April 1, 2013.
